Peer-to-Peer Mobility Management for all-IP Networks
2006
2006 IEEE International Conference on Communications
With the increasing number of wireless devices, the importance of mobility management in future mobile networks is growing. Traditional mobility management approaches are based on client/server paradigms, and suffer from their well-known shortcomings (single point of failure, congestion, bottlenecks).
